Overview
The BC857BW-AU_R1_000A1 is a PNP general-purpose bipolar junction transistor (BJT) manufactured by Panjit International Inc. This transistor is designed for a wide range of applications, including general-purpose amplification and switching. It features a small SOT-323 (SC-70) surface-mount package, making it suitable for compact and efficient electronic designs.
Key Specifications
Parameter | Symbol | Value | Units |
---|---|---|---|
Collector - Emitter Voltage | VCEO | -45 | V |
Collector - Base Voltage | VCBO | -50 | V |
Emitter - Base Voltage | VEBO | 6 | V |
Collector Current - Continuous | IC | 100 | mA |
Power Dissipation | PTOT | 250 | mW |
Storage Temperature Range | TSTG | -55 to 150 | °C |
Junction Temperature Range | TJ | -55 to 150 | °C |
Thermal Resistance (Junction to Ambient) | RθJA | 500 | °C/W |
Base - Emitter Voltage (Saturation) | VBE(SAT) | 0.7 - 0.9 | V |
Current-Gain Bandwidth Product | fT | 200 | MHz |
Key Features
- General Purpose Amplifier Applications: Suitable for a wide range of amplification and switching tasks.
- PNP Epitaxial Silicon, Planar Design: Ensures high performance and reliability in various operating conditions.
- Small SOT-323 (SC-70) Package: Compact surface-mount design ideal for space-constrained applications.
- AEC-Q101 Qualified: Meets automotive industry standards for reliability and performance.
- Lead-Free and RoHS Compliant: Complies with EU RoHS 2011/65/EU directives and uses halogen-free green molding compound.
- High Current-Gain Bandwidth Product: Up to 200 MHz, making it suitable for high-frequency applications.
